How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Lake Terrace?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Lake Terrace Studio Apartments | $1,759 | $1,146 | $3,820 |
Lake Terrace 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,902 | $543 | $4,989 |
Lake Terrace 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,216 | $1,086 | $6,204 |
Lake Terrace 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,946 | $1,255 | $8,352 |
